Recipes 1 and 2 would taste the same but Recipe 3 would taste different. This is because both Recipe 1 and 2 use a 2:3 ratio, while Recipe 3 uses a 3:4 ratio.
The ratio for Recipe 1 is 4:6 and for Recipe 2 is 6:9, which when simplified is 2:3.
Meanwhile the ratio for Recipe 3 is 9:12, which simplified is 3:4.
